Output 3facc97a79627cea652fd82fb00bf083126afff59a3c456637ea805ea22f67e5:62

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 580d4f49eddec8e86569f66853a339a490f1858f84d73bc7fee4d2f4d43a9999
address
bc1ptqx57j0dmmywsetf7e598gee5jg0rpv0sntnh3l7unf0f4p6nxvs5cx0dw
transaction
3facc97a79627cea652fd82fb00bf083126afff59a3c456637ea805ea22f67e5
spent
true